#e19353 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e19353 is composed of 88.2% red, 57.6% green and 32.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 34.7% magenta, 63.1%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 27 degrees, a saturation of 70.3% and a lightness of 60.4%. #e19353 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ffa6 with #c32700. Closest websafe color is: #cc9966.

Shades and Tints of #e19353

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0602 is the darkest color, while #fefcf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#e19353

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9b9a99 is the less saturated color, while #f8913c is the most saturated one.
